Apple’s iOS 27: A Focus on Stability and Refinement
What’s Happened? Apple is set to release its next major iOS update, iOS 27, which is being crafted as a “Snow Leopard-style” release. This means that, much like the 2009 Mac OS X Snow Leopard, the update will emphasize refinement, stability, and comprehensive cleanup rather than introduce a flurry of new features.
- This approach mirrors the highly successful strategy of Snow Leopard, which focused on overhauling core components, reducing bloat, and enhancing performance.
- Apple’s engineering teams are actively combing through the operating system to eliminate unnecessary elements, fix bugs, and remove legacy code—all aimed at boosting system performance.

Why Is This Important?
iOS 27 follows iOS 26, which introduced a radical redesign with the Liquid Glass user interface. While many found the new interface visually appealing, it also brought along various bugs, including:
- Overheating issues
- Excessive battery drain
- UI glitches and animation lag
- Failures in the keyboard functionality
- Connectivity troubles
As an example, I’ve experienced multiple issues on my iPhone 17, such as the brightness slider getting stuck and the camera app activating macro mode unexpectedly.
For years, Apple has faced pressure to compete with rival mobile and AI technologies, diverting focus away from quality control in their operating system.
Why Should You Care?
The enhancements in iOS 27 promise to dramatically improve the day-to-day reliability for both newer and older iPhones. This is reminiscent of how Snow Leopard optimized the Mac experience for years to follow.
- Some anticipated AI improvements, such as a more efficient Siri and expanded in-app intelligence, will help streamline daily tasks.
- Additionally, users can expect iOS 27 to feel considerably faster, cleaner, and more efficient, potentially enhancing the battery life of compatible devices.

What’s Next?
Refining iOS also sets the stage for future iPhone models, including the highly anticipated foldable iPhone expected to debut in September 2026. Despite the focus on refinement, iOS 27 may still introduce a limited number of new features, primarily driven by Apple’s ongoing advancements in artificial intelligence:
- A more capable Siri and enhanced AI-based search functionalities
- A new health-focused AI integrated with Health+
In the meantime, Apple continues to adjust the iOS 26 interface, adding new customization options for Lock Screen glass effects, indicating that fine-tuning efforts are still very much a priority.
